From the shop floor to the customer service area, FastPoint light pens are the input device of choice for
automotive diagnostics systems and shop management applications. |
|
| Light Pen Advantages: |
|
- More Intuitive
As you can imagine, picking up a light pen and pointing it to where you want the cursor to go is a more intuitive way to interact with the computer.
- Industrial Input Device
Grease and grime left on hands and surfaces can render mice, keyboards, and touch screens inoperable. FastPoint light pens provide the solution for input device failures because
they resist grease buildup and prevent direct on-screen hand contact.
- Shielded
FastPoint light pens are shielded against interference from electrostatic discharges (ESD), radio frequencies, and electro-magnetic interference (EMI) generated by equipment commonly found in
automotive environments.
- Resistant to Grease and Oil
The solid body construction of the light pen barrel and protected wire connections makes FastPoint light pens resistant to water, oil and grease.
- Works with Any CRT Monitor
FastPoint light pens are designed to work with all CRT (Cathode Ray Tube) monitors. Whether you use an existing CRT monitor or are purchasing new monitors, FastPoint light pens will work
with both.
